Job Summary
Instrumentational Electrician responsible for both instrumentation and electrical work: install, maintain, and repair automated valves and field instrumentation; troubleshoot plant process control systems; install and maintain electrical wiring/conduit, switches, motor control centers, and breakers. Requires reading P&ID drawings, electrical schematics, and control wiring sheets; proficient with CMMS systems (e.g., Tabware); strong troubleshooting and safety mindset; will operate in a unionized Hammond, IN facility with ISO 9001/RCMS compliance and OSHA/EPA protocols.
Required Qualifications
- High school or GED
- At least five (5) years of industrial experience in a chemical plant or related industry
- Knowledge of instrumentation and process control systems
- Ability to read and follow P&ID drawings
- Ability to read and create electrical and circuit diagrams
- Experience with CMMS (Tabware or similar)
- Strong troubleshooting skills
- Knowledge of electric codes and electrical safety
- Ability to interpret blueprints and wiring diagrams
- Ability to work with PPE and adhere to OSHA regulations
